Car is unknown to me, but can you ask to see the servicing proof and notes that may confirm or deny your suspicion? Also will allow you to see any notes for areas that may require attention in your ownership and most importantly, hybrid health check certificates.

Or simply contact the Lexus dealer it was serviced at and say you are looking to buy, just want to check its history etc etc - worth a shot?

Before I would even consider the trip. Ask for video of it running, bonnet open etc (surely dealer will oblige, considering your potential round trip). As with most older cars, check for recent or lack of fluids being changed, belts, tensioners, pulleys, steering or suspension components, discs, pads all your wear and tear items etc - again if full Lexus history, dealer should be able to check through paperwork to provide the info.
